It's very likely that the next match day in the Greek super league is not going to take place as scheduled.
Referees decided to strike and formally announced their decision, forwarded in a letter to UEFA.
They're citing threats received by Mr. Papapetrou, a local referee who was overseeing the adventurous match between Olympiacos and Volos.
